Overview of Cleaning Methods



When picking a cleaning method, recognizing the distinctions in between pressure washing and standard cleansing strategies is vital.

Pressure washing usages high-pressure water jets to eliminate dirt, grime, and spots from surface areas like driveways, decks, and siding. This technique is efficient, particularly for difficult, stubborn spots that may stand up to traditional cleaning.

On https://showroom-cleaning-company66543.theobloggers.com/38967567/revitalize-your-concrete-top-tips-for-effective-surface-area-cleansing , standard cleansing generally involves scrubbing surfaces with brushes, mops, or towels, usually combined with cleaning agents or soaps. It's an extra hands-on technique, counting on physical effort and time to achieve tidiness.

Traditional techniques can be reliable, but they may not address deeply deep-rooted dirt or huge areas as rapidly as pressure washing can.

Additionally, https://www.realhomes.com/advice/how-to-clean-upholstery need to consider the surfaces you're cleaning. While pressure cleaning is excellent for sturdy surface areas, it might damage softer products or sensitive locations otherwise done thoroughly.

Standard cleansing approaches tend to be much safer for different surface areas but may require more effort and time.

Inevitably, your selection relies on the cleansing task available, the kind of surface area, and your wanted end result. By comprehending these approaches, you can make an enlightened decision that fulfills your cleansing needs.

Conveniences of Stress Washing



Stress washing deals several advantages that make it a recommended choice for lots of cleaning jobs. First and foremost, it saves you time. With high-pressure water streams, you can clean big locations in a fraction of the time it would take with standard methods. This efficiency enables you to tackle tasks like driveways, decks, and exterior siding quickly.



You'll additionally find that stress washing is very efficient in getting rid of persistent dust, gunk, mold and mildew, and mildew. The force of the water permeates surfaces, raising away impurities that could be challenging to remove with a brush or fabric. This not just boosts the appearance of your residential or commercial property but also aids maintain its value in time.

One more substantial benefit is the eco-friendliness of stress cleaning. It typically calls for less chemicals than typical cleansing approaches, counting mainly on water to do the task. This implies you're lowering your chemical impact while still achieving superb results.

Finally, stress cleaning boosts safety and security by removing slippery mold and algae on surfaces. By maintaining your pathways and driveways clean, you're lowering the threat of mishaps, making your home a much safer place for you and your guests.

Benefits of Standard Cleansing



Typical cleaning techniques have their own set of advantages that make them appealing for certain tasks. One of the essential advantages is the control you have more than the cleansing process. You can customize the method and products to fit the particular surface or material, ensuring you do not harm anything delicate. This is especially vital when managing antiques or sensitive fabrics.

In addition, standard cleansing frequently makes use of much less water than pressure washing, making it an extra environmentally friendly option. You're likewise less likely to disrupt bordering areas or produce drainage that can affect your landscape design.

Expense is another aspect to think about. Standard cleaning techniques generally require less ahead of time financial investments in equipment contrasted to push cleaning devices, which can be expensive. Plus, you can usually locate cleansing products at any regional store, making them easily accessible and practical.

Lastly, the hands-on strategy of conventional cleaning permits you to connect a lot more with your area. You can focus on detail and notice locations that might require extra care. In many cases, this thoroughness results in a deeper tidy, ensuring you keep your home or work space successfully.
